I suggest that, like here in Louisiana, that the
counties (parishes), issue CHL’s within them, limited
to those map lines.
The State-wide CHL, for some folks, is too costly,
and not useful, if their world of operation, exists
within their parish/county lines. Sure, if they go
beyond that, their piece goes in the trunk, until
they are in their resident parish.
I do this, because I don’t own a vehicle; my
world is within the parish; and my errands are
accomplished with a friend’s help.
Louisiana just made the State CHL costs
$500.00 for 5 years in one charge!
The parish charged me a whole $50.00, for the
initial fee, and every year since, a whole
$10.00 to renew it.
